Maintaining SEO during a website redesign or migration requires meticulous planning before launch and precise technical execution afterward. The statistics are sobering: only 10% of migrations improve SEO, while 50% traffic loss is common with an average recovery time of 523 days. However, well-executed migrations tell a different story—one case study documented a +130% increase in impressions and +63% increase in clicks by implementing a structured migration strategy. The difference between these outcomes hinges on preparation: migrations are 70% planning and 30% execution, meaning the months before your redesign launch determine whether your organic traffic rebounds or stagnates for over a year.
The core challenge is that search engines see a redesign or migration as potentially losing relevance signals from your old site. Every redirect you miss is SEO equity left on the table. Every piece of structured data you forget to port over is a lost opportunity for rich snippets or AI-generated answer box placements. Every poorly planned URL structure change fragments your domain authority across pages that should be accumulating power together. This article walks through the specific technical and strategic steps that prevent these failures, incorporating guidance from Google’s official migration documentation and real-world case studies that achieved measurable success.

Why Website Redesigns and Migrations Cause SEO Traffic Drops
The reason migrations are so risky is that they disrupt nearly everything Google uses to rank your site. When you change URLs, move content, alter site architecture, or switch domains, Google must re-crawl, re-index, and re-evaluate your pages. During this transition period—which can last weeks to months—your rankings typically fluctuate. A 5–10% dip in rankings in the first few weeks is normal and expected; anything beyond that signals implementation problems that require immediate investigation. Poorly executed migrations cause 30% organic traffic declines and over 50% revenue decreases for three consecutive months. The financial impact is severe because rankings don’t recover overnight.
Post-migration seo recovery typically continues for several months, and without a proper migration plan, some sites never recover their pre-migration authority. Conversely, well-planned migrations achieve 40% organic traffic increases by month three, demonstrating that the planning investment pays dividends quickly. The stakes scale with your business size. A mid-market website losing 30% organic traffic for 90 days might lose six figures in revenue. A small business could lose more—not in absolute dollars, but as a percentage of total traffic. Understanding these risks upfront is what motivates the level of detail required in a proper migration plan.

Implementing 301 Redirects and URL Mapping for SEO Power Transfer
The technical foundation of any migration is the redirect strategy. When you move a page from an old URL to a new URL, a 301 permanent redirect tells Google that the new URL is the permanent home of that content. Critically, 301 redirects pass nearly all ranking power from old URLs to new ones, allowing your new pages to inherit the SEO value accumulated by the old pages. Without these redirects, old URLs that no longer exist return 404 errors, which do not pass SEO value and can cause pages to be removed from the search index entirely. The implementation requires creating a complete URL mapping from every old page to its corresponding new page, then implementing server-side 301 or 308 redirects. A 308 redirect functions identically to 301 for SEO purposes but is the more modern HTTP standard.
The critical mistake teams make is creating redirect chains—old URL → intermediate URL → final URL. Each hop in the chain causes some SEO value to leak away. Instead, map directly: old URL → new URL, one hop. If you’re migrating domains, use Google Search Console’s “Change of Address” tool to formally notify Google of the migration, which accelerates the reindexing process. A practical limitation: if you have thousands of old URLs, manual mapping becomes tedious and error-prone. Export your old URLs from your server logs or Google Search Console, programmatically match them to new URLs by pattern matching (if you’ve reorganized URLs systematically), then batch-import the redirect rules into your web server configuration or redirect management tool. Even one missed redirect materially affects domain authority distribution, particularly for high-authority pages identified through backlink audits.
Preserving Content Structure, Metadata, and Structured Data
Beyond redirects, your content itself must be preserved and accurately replicated in the new site. Preserve URL structure consistency—avoid arbitrary changes to slug patterns unless necessary. Keep internal linking intact by ensuring that internal links in your new site point to the correct new URLs, not old ones. Maintain your heading structure (H1, H2, H3 hierarchy) because search engines use this to understand content organization. Critical metadata elements—title tags, meta descriptions, canonical tags, and structured data—must be ported exactly as they were, not recreated from scratch.
Structured data (Schema.org markup, JSON-LD) is especially important because it powers rich snippets and Google’s AI-generated answer boxes. If a piece of content appeared in an AI-generated answer box before migration, losing the schema markup almost guarantees you’ll lose that placement after migration, even if the content is identical. Similarly, if your pages have FAQ schema, product schema, or event schema, migrating those verbatim preserves the search appearance you’ve already earned. The limitation here is complexity: larger sites with hundreds or thousands of pages may have inconsistent metadata across the old site, and the migration provides an opportunity to clean it up. However, cleaning up metadata during a migration simultaneously creates two sources of change for Google to process, compounding the ranking fluctuation risk. A safer approach: complete the migration first with metadata identical to the old site, verify ranking stabilization over 4-6 weeks, then make metadata improvements in a second phase.

Setting Up Google Search Console and Tracking Migration Events
Google Search Console is your command center for communicating with Google about your migration. After implementing your redirects and deploying the new site, submit your new domain (or subdirectory, if applicable) as a new property in Google Search Console. Then, use the “Change of Address” tool to formally notify Google that you’ve migrated from the old domain. This tells Google to re-evaluate your entire site under the new address faster than organic crawling would otherwise discover it. Once the migration is live, monitor your Search Console data obsessively for the first 8 weeks. Watch for drops in indexed pages—if Google reports significantly fewer indexed pages on the new domain than the old domain had indexed, you have redirect or content issues.
Track clicks and impressions to spot ranking losses; a 5–10% dip is expected, but larger drops warrant investigation. As of 2026, Google Search Console now includes custom annotations, allowing you to mark migration events directly in your performance reports. This lets you correlate traffic changes with the migration itself, making it easier to distinguish migration-related dips from algorithmic changes or competitive shifts. Submit your updated sitemap to Google Search Console after migration. Google reports indexed vs. discovered URLs, giving you visibility into whether new pages are being crawled and indexed successfully. If you notice a large discrepancy between discovered and indexed pages, it usually indicates content quality or duplicate content issues that need fixing.
Monitoring Performance Metrics and Avoiding Post-Migration Pitfalls
A common mistake is assuming that once the migration is technically complete, SEO work is finished. In reality, the first 8–12 weeks after launch are when ranking fluctuations occur, and continuous monitoring allows you to catch and fix problems before they compound. Track three metrics: search rankings for your high-value keywords, organic traffic from Google Search Console, and page load times. Page speed becomes critical after a redesign because your new site may be heavier or less optimized than the old one. Slow pages directly hurt both user experience and SEO. 53% of mobile visitors abandon pages that take more than 3 seconds to load, and a delay of just 2 extra seconds triggers a +103% bounce rate increase.
These aren’t hypothetical penalties—they’re conversion losses that also affect dwell time and rankings. One case study improved page load times by 87%, from 15+ seconds down to under 2 seconds, which directly improved both conversion rates and search rankings. A warning: if you notice your site performing worse than expected post-migration, resist the urge to panic-change things. Small tweaks to redirects, content, or site structure during the recovery phase create additional ranking volatility. Instead, let the site stabilize for 4 weeks, document what you observe, then decide on next steps. The exception is broken redirects or 404 pages, which should be fixed immediately.

High-Authority Page Priority and Domain Authority Distribution
Not all pages are equally valuable. Some pages have accumulated years of backlinks, social signals, and user engagement, and they carry disproportionate weight in your site’s overall authority. Before migration, identify these high-authority pages using backlink analysis tools (Ahrefs, SEMrush, Moz) and Google Search Console’s Links report.
These pages deserve special attention: ensure their redirects are flawless, their metadata is pristine, and their new URLs are live and crawlable immediately. Missing even one redirect for a high-authority page materially affects domain authority distribution. A single popular page that returns 404 instead of redirecting means that page’s accumulated authority is lost, and all the internal links pointing to it from other pages on your site don’t transfer their value forward. In a medium-sized site, this might cost you 5–10 ranking positions on competitive keywords.
The Long-Term SEO Impact and Planning Beyond Launch
Recovery from migration typically continues for several months even with a perfect implementation. Month one brings ranking volatility; month two and three often show rankings rebounding as Google finishes reindexing. A well-planned migration often shows ranking gains by month three, not losses, because teams use the redesign opportunity to improve content quality, page speed, and technical SEO simultaneously.
The key is viewing the migration not as a necessary evil, but as a strategic moment to strengthen your SEO foundation. Looking ahead, maintain a migration documentation file for your team. Document the old-to-new URL mapping, redirect implementation, any content changes, and the timeline. This becomes invaluable if questions arise months or years later, and it helps your team avoid repeating mistakes on future redesigns.
Conclusion
Maintaining SEO during a website redesign or migration is fundamentally about planning, precision, and patience. The 70/30 rule—70% planning and 30% execution—reflects the reality that migration success is determined in the months before launch through detailed URL mapping, metadata auditing, and redirect strategies. Technical execution matters, but only if it’s built on a solid plan. Start your migration project by creating a complete audit of your current site: URL structure, metadata, redirects, high-authority pages, and internal linking. Map every old URL to its new counterpart.
Implement 301 redirects for every page. Preserve all metadata and structured data. Test the new site thoroughly before launch. After launch, monitor Google Search Console, search rankings, and page performance for the first 8–12 weeks, but avoid making major changes during the recovery period. By following these steps, you position your site to achieve the outcomes seen in successful migrations: ranking stability or gains by month three and full recovery within a few months rather than the common 523-day struggle.
